Following his release from prison, Jamaican dancehall star Vybz Kartel has endorsed Shatta Wale as he announces his allegiance to the Shatta Movement (SM) brand owned by the Ghanaian singer.
In a recent Instagram post, Vybz Kartel publicly declared his full membership in the movement as a gesture of gratitude for Shatta Wale’s unwavering support during his imprisonment.
Throughout Vybz Kartel’s arrest, Shatta Wale has consistently demonstrated loyalty and support for Kartel and the Gaza family on social media.
This steadfastness has earned Shatta Wale a reputation for being a true friend and ally, solidifying his bond with the Jamaican artist.

Shatta Wale is known as the “African Dancehall King” not just for his vocal talent but also for his similar lifestyle he shares with Kartel in his songs.
He often praises Kartel, expressing his admiration and desire to emulate the dancehall icon.
The ‘On God’ has always acknowledged Kartel as a role model and inspiration to his musical career.
However, in a post on Instagram, Vybz Kartel affirmed his affiliation with the Shatta Movement, led by Shatta Wale.
The post, sighted by Hellovybes, features Kartel responding to a message from Shatta Wale, publicly declaring his allegiance to the SM brand.
This endorsement has inspired more online reactions, assuring fans that the two musicians’ mutual respect is genuine and long lasting.
